Petco Park San Diego

Petco parkIf you are down in San Diego during Padre season, you have to go to a game at Petco park.
Petco Park opened in 2004 and is nestled in downtown San Diego close to the convention center. This open-air ballpark has an old time feel to it and is a must see when visiting San Diego.
Home of the Padres, the park was named after the pet supply retailer Petco. I know, did I state the obvious?
The ballpark is located between 7th and 10th avenues, South of J Street. The southern side of the stadium has the trolley access. Near K Street between 7th and 10th is now closed to automobiles and serves as a pedestrian promenade along the back of the left and center field outfield seating.
